#68d5ff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#68d5ff is composed of 40.8% red, 83.5% green and 100%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 59.2% cyan, 16.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 0% black. It has a hue angle of 196.7 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 70.4%. #68d5ff color hex could be obtained by blending #d0ffff with #00abff. Closest websafe color is: #66ccff.

Shades and Tints of #68d5ff

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000406 is the darkest color, while #f1fbff is the lightest one.

Tones of #68d5ff

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#aeb6b9 is the less saturated color, while #68d5ff is the most saturated one.
